How to Overcome a Gambling Addiction

gambling

Whether it is a scratch card, roulette wheel, slot machine or a bet on a sporting event, gambling involves risking something of value in the hope of winning something else of greater value. It stimulates the brain’s reward system much like drugs and alcohol can, and can lead to addiction. Problem gambling can strain relationships, interfere with work, and even cause financial disaster. It can also lead to hiding behavior, lying to family and friends, and even theft and fraud to support the habit.

There are several things that can help someone overcome a gambling addiction. A therapist can teach healthy coping strategies and identify underlying conditions that may be contributing to the problem, such as depression or anxiety. They can also teach people to recognize their unhealthy gambling behaviors and replace them with healthier ones. In addition, a therapist can help a person develop financial, work, and relationship skills to cope with problems caused by compulsive gambling.

Gambling is considered an addictive behavior because it involves the risking of something of value in the hope of gaining something of greater value, often involving chance or skill. It requires a consideration of the probability of the outcome and a ratio of the risks to rewards. The process of determining these odds can be described mathematically, and the resulting values are called expected returns. In insurance, the actuary uses similar methods to determine appropriate premiums, and this approach is sometimes used by gamblers to select which bets to place.

The earliest step in overcoming a gambling addiction is admitting that there is a problem. This can be a difficult step, especially for those who have suffered strained or broken relationships, financial hardship or other consequences of their gambling. The next step is to find a support network. This can include family and friends, or peer groups such as Gamblers Anonymous, a 12-step recovery program modeled after Alcoholics Anonymous. It is important to remember that there are other ways to relieve unpleasant feelings and to socialize, such as exercising, spending time with non-gambling friends, or taking up new hobbies.

It is important to set limits and stick to them. This can mean setting money and time limits before starting to play, and leaving when you reach them, whether you are winning or losing. It is also important to avoid gambling when you are depressed, upset or in pain. These are the times when you are most likely to make poor decisions. Also, don’t try to make up for lost money by gambling more. This usually leads to bigger losses. Finally, always gamble with money you can afford to lose and don’t use your credit cards to gamble. Never chase your losses; this will only make them worse. Lastly, never gamble when you are tired or hungry. This will also influence your decision-making.

The Risks and Benefits of Gambling in the UK

gambling

Gambling is an activity where you risk something of value (usually money) in the hope of winning something of greater value. It is a popular pastime for many people and can be quite enjoyable, especially when things go your way. However, for some people, gambling becomes addictive and can cause problems with family, finances, work and relationships. It can also lead to serious debt and even homelessness. There is also a significant risk of suicide associated with problem gambling.

It is important to be aware of the risks of gambling and to seek help if you think you might have a problem. You should only gamble with disposable income and not money that you need to save or use for bills. It is also important to not gamble when you are stressed, upset or emotionally down. These emotions make it more difficult to make good decisions and can lead to bad ones such as chasing losses which will almost always result in further losses.

Many different types of gambling are available in the UK, from scratchcards and fruit machines to football accumulators and horse racing. There are also online casinos and betting apps. The risk of gambling depends on how much you bet, how often you gamble and how much you win or lose. The more you bet, the higher the chances of losing and the bigger your losses will be. The odds of winning vary depending on the type of game and the skill level of the player.

The most common type of gambling is a game of chance, such as a slot machine or video poker. Other types of gambling include playing card games, casino table games, sports events and lotteries. People can also gamble by investing in business or financial markets. Some people also gamble by speculating on political or economic events, including elections and stock market crashes.

A key problem with gambling is that it stimulates the brain’s reward system in the same way as drugs or alcohol do. This can lead to addiction, which is sometimes referred to as compulsive gambling disorder or pathological gambling. Pathological gambling is associated with high levels of comorbidity with other disorders, such as depression and anxiety.

There are no FDA-approved medications to treat gambling disorder. However, some antidepressants and anti-anxiety drugs can be helpful in treating underlying mood disorders that may contribute to gambling disorder. In addition, behavioral therapy and support groups can be helpful in helping individuals overcome gambling disorder.

The first step in overcoming gambling disorder is admitting that you have a problem. This can be very hard, particularly if you have lost a large amount of money or have strained or broken relationships as a result of your gambling. It is important to remember that you are not alone in your struggle and that others have successfully broken the habit and rebuilt their lives. If you are struggling, it is worth considering seeking professional help, such as counseling, inpatient treatment or a residential program.

What is a Lottery?

lottery

A lottery is a game in which people purchase numbered tickets and are then drawn for prizes. People often buy multiple entries to increase their chances of winning. Some lotteries are run by states and give a percentage of profits to good causes. Others are run by private organizations, such as churches or charities. In the United States, state governments regulate the operation of lotteries and determine the rules governing them.

The lottery is a form of gambling, in which people are paid to win prizes by chance. Prizes are usually money, but can also be goods or services. The odds of winning the lottery are very low, but many people still play. Lotteries are legal in most jurisdictions and are an important source of revenue for state governments. They are one of the few government activities that can be considered a vice, but they are not nearly as harmful as alcohol or tobacco, which are legalized for similar reasons.

There are a number of different types of lotteries, including state and national lotteries, instant games, and scratch-off games. State-sponsored lotteries are typically decentralized and overseen by a commission or board, which may be responsible for licensing and training retailers, promoting the lottery to potential customers, and paying high-tier prizes to winners. In addition to running state-sponsored lotteries, some states also regulate privately run lotteries, and many offer online versions of their games.

A state-sponsored lottery is a type of gambling wherein the winners are determined by drawing lots. The word “lottery” is derived from the Latin Lottera, meaning fate or destiny, and it means the distribution of something by chance. Lotteries are popular around the world and can be used for a variety of purposes, from awarding prizes to children’s summer camps to determining who gets a green card.

Lotteries are games of chance in which numbers are randomly selected and the winners receive a prize. While some people believe that playing the lottery is a waste of money, others argue that it provides entertainment value and benefits society by raising funds for public goods. Lotteries are a common feature of many countries’ economies and have been in existence for centuries. The practice of distributing property by lot is documented in the Old Testament, when Moses was instructed to take a census of the people of Israel and divide their land accordingly. The Roman emperors also gave away property and slaves through lotteries during Saturnalian feasts and other entertaining events.
